There are various types of toothpastes available in the market, each designed to target specific dental issues. Here’s what you should consider when selecting the perfect toothpaste:
  • Fluoride Content: Look for toothpastes that contain fluoride, as it helps in preventing cavities.
  • Whitening Agents: If you’re looking to brighten your smile, consider toothpastes with whitening properties.
  • Sensitivity Relief: For those with sensitive teeth, there are specialized toothpastes that can provide relief.
  • Natural Ingredients: If you prefer organic products, opt for toothpastes made with natural ingredients.
  • Flavor: Choose a flavor that you enjoy, as it can make your brushing experience more pleasant.
